Usage

Former members of the U.S. House of Representatives

Example—
Newt Gingrich
:

{{s-start}}
{{US House succession box
| state    = Georgia
| district =6| before   = [[Jack Flynt]]
| after    = [[Johnny Isakson]]
| years    = January 3, 1979 – January 3, 1999
}}
{{s-end}}

becomes:

Preceded by

Jack Flynt

Member of the U.S. House of Representatives
from Georgia's 6th congressional district

January 3, 1979 – January 3, 1999
Succeeded by

Johnny Isakson

Incumbents

First example—
John Carney
:

{{s-start}}
{{US House succession box
| state= Delaware
| district=AL| before= [[Michael N. Castle]]
| start= January 3, 2011}}
{{s-end}}

becomes:

Preceded by

Michael N. Castle

Member of the U.S. House of Representatives
from Delaware's at-large congressional district

January 3, 2011 – present
Incumbent

If there is only one district for the entire state, then use "AL," the at-large district.
